***PLEASE READ THE RULES PRIOR TO COMING***
The primary goal of these rules is to protect the health and safety of BTC members and the general public we come in contact with during our events. Further, maintaining our privilege and permit to swim at Wilkeson Pointe in Lake Erie depends on following these rules.
If you feel sick in any way, please be extra cautious and stay home.
Activities are only held when WNY is designated Phase 4 or higher by the NY Governor.
Swim events take place in public spaces. BTC members will respect the rights and safety of the general public, yielding to non-members whenever a social distance conflict arises (e.x. trying to enter the Lake Erie access ramp).
Attendance is for paid member swimmers only. Differing from past years, these are not social hangout events, they are athletic workout events only.
Group size is limited to 25 at one time. Future group sizes may increase at Board discretion.
Participation is on a first come first served basis.
BTC Board Members and designated volunteer coordinators have final say on head count and admittance of participants as they arrive.
Maintain social distance of at least 6 feet from other people at all times.
Cones/markers will be arranged in the transition areas indicating proper spots to set up a towel to change your gear.
Members living under the same roof may share a transition spot, careful to ensure they do not spill over into the 6 foot distance of neighboring athletes.
All participants will wear a face covering/mask at all times other than when in the water.
Hand sanitizer will be available at any touch points (e.x. The sign in sheet area)
Ramp Access
Only one direction of travel at a time will be allowed on the ramp, maintaining 6 foot distance. Volunteers will be at the top and bottom to coordinate.
General public gets priority access to the ramp over BTC members.
No Dock Loitering - BTC members will clear the dock promptly when entering/exiting the water.
Sign-in will take place in the BTC tent set up a short distance away from the ramp, differing from previous years clipboard location.
The parking situation is challenging at Wilkeson Pointe. Members must make every effort to maintain social distance.
The beach area is very limited at Porter, space for only 3 or 4 people while maintaining social distance.
Members must transition/change up in the parking area where there is more space to spread out.
General public gets priority access to the beach over BTC members.
